Output 3587630997c5bc22edc466a7a5c465276273ab10bf867c85936309cc3c2f0ead:1

value
382155179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bdf35f68b37298520d9f572744c2a20f794d30f OP_EQUAL
address
MEpLJmvGXhW18mYDeZj3o5eWvuotkYUDmM
transaction
3587630997c5bc22edc466a7a5c465276273ab10bf867c85936309cc3c2f0ead
spent
true